After 20 years in Italy, Elaine Trigiani has designed experiences that bring Italian foods and culture to people all over the world. Today on Deep South Dining Malcolm, Carol, and Elaine are talking pasta, and wine, and will even taste test olive oil. Elaine has managed to keep her Mississippi roots even while cooking in her Italian kitchen and bridges the gap with talk of mustard greens and okra. Also, zucchini is on the menu with its origins rooted in Italy, and August 8 being National Sneak Some Zucchini Onto Your Neighbor's Porch Day. Let's eat yall!
